To earn the Pennsylvania Bar Association’s workers’ compensation specialist certification, an attorney must meet a set of experience requirements before they can even sit for the exam. That means a minimum number of workers’ comp cases handled, a minimum number of depositions taken, specific types of petitions filed, and work with expert witnesses and judges at multiple levels. Once those requirements are satisfied, the attorney sits for a full-day written examination. Pass the exam, and the certification is earned.

What This Means For Your Workers’ Comp Case
When you hire a certified specialist, you’re working with an attorney who has demonstrated a specific and verifiable depth of experience in workers’ comp law. They’ve handled the types of claims that get complicated — disputes over medical treatment, average weekly wage calculation errors, termination of benefits, and appeals before the Workers’ Compensation Appeal Board and Commonwealth Court.
Workers’ comp is a distinct area of law with its own courts, judges, and procedures. It’s not a sub-specialty of personal injury — it operates entirely differently. An attorney who handles it at the level required for certification brings a different level of preparation to your case from day one.
